Client Access Role will not re-install and now Exchange will not run
I have a situation where OWA was not working due to a conflict with a .NET update. I had to re-install IIS and following Microsoft KB 320202 I uninstalled the Client Access Role. There was an error about the OAB as it was on this server, re-created it on another server and un-installation preceded correctly. Upon re-installing the CAR however, it failed with: Event Type: Error Event Source: MSExchangeSetup Event Category: Microsoft Exchange Setup Event ID: 1002 Date: 7/01/2008 Time: 8:18:30 PM User: N/A Computer: Servername Description: Exchange Server component Client Access Role failed. Error: Error: This role cannot be installed because the following roles are not current: BridgeheadRole MailboxRole None of the exchange services start up now, for instance: Event Type: Error Event Source: MSExchangeSA Event Category: General Event ID: 1005 Date: 7/01/2008 Time: 9:00:56 PM User: N/A Computer: ServernameDescription: Unexpected error The system could not find the environment option that was entered. Facility: Win32 ID no: c00700cb Microsoft Exchange System Attendant occurred. and Event Type: Error Event Source: MSExchangeIS Event Category: General Event ID: 1121 Date: 7/01/2008 Time: 9:24:01 PM User: N/A Computer: ServernameDescription: Error 0x8004010f connecting to the Microsoft Active Directory. Any help/assistance would be appreciated.

It appears that I am and that the Microsoft Exchange Active Directory Topology service is now missing.Event Type: ErrorEvent Source: MSExchangeISEvent Category: General Event ID: 1121Date: 8/01/2008Time: 8:44:16 AMUser: N/AComputer: ServernameDescription:Error 0x8004010f connecting to the Microsoft Active Directory. Event Type: ErrorEvent Source: MSExchangeISEvent Category: General Event ID: 5000Date: 8/01/2008Time: 8:44:16 AMUser: N/AComputer: ServernameDescription:Unable to initialize the Microsoft Exchange Information Store service. - Error 0x8004010f. Event Type: ErrorEvent Source: Service Control ManagerEvent Category: NoneEvent ID: 7003Date: 8/01/2008Time: 8:43:34 AMUser: N/AComputer: ServernameDescription:The Microsoft Exchange Transport service depends on the following nonexistent service: MSExchangeADTopology

If your "Microsoft Exchange Active Directory Topology service" is not running then almost nothing will work on your exchange installation. is the service still there, can it be started? make sure that your server is asking a DNs server containing AD information and not a DNS server on Internet when doing internal lookup.
